Output ddbf981a15cab622be3c97a2597d5ed3a8a48ff7ff6cca765f943406873c7a13:2

value
752629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c2f04e1d7d8b50e0baf14e27463a75e275867a1 OP_EQUAL
address
38dqc4jagfjeAzMWo4z1HziqUuqa4RuFAE
transaction
ddbf981a15cab622be3c97a2597d5ed3a8a48ff7ff6cca765f943406873c7a13
spent
true